- The distance between Atchison, Ks, Usa and Kengtung, Myanmar is approximately 13,076 km or 8,126 mi.
- To reach Atchison, Ks in this distance one would set out from Kengtung bearing 12.8°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Atchison, Ks bearing 164.5° or SSE .
- Atchison, Ks has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Kengtung has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Atchison, Ks is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Kengtung is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 11 °C (19.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 20.1 °C (36.2°F) more in Atchison, Ks.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 360.6 mm (14.2 in) less which is equivalent to 360.6 l/m² (8.85 US gal/ft²) or 3,606,000 l/ha (385,505 US gal/ac) less. About 5/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.8° lower in Atchison, Ks than in Kengtung.
